PO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)

PO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2010 2015 2021
Population 24 727 25 852 27 024 27 089 29 087 31 605 32 026 32 083
Average density (inhab / km²) 170,6 178,3 186,4 186,8 200,6 218,0 220,9 221,3
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2024.
  • Sources: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ts, RP2010 to RP2021 main holdings.

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968
Demographic indicators 1968 to 1975 1975 to 1982 1982 to 1990 1990 to 1999 1999 to 2010 2010 to 2015 2015 to 2021
Average annual change in population in % 0,6 0,6 0,0 0,8 0,8 0,3 0,0
due to the natural balance in % 0,3 0,2 0,1 –0,0 –0,2 –0,5 –0,7
due to the apparent balance of inflows and outflows in % 0,3 0,4 –0,0 0,8 0,9 0,8 0,7
Natality rate (‰) 16,6 14,2 12,5 11,7 10,4 7,5 6,8
Mortality rate (‰) 13,1 12,1 11,8 11,8 12,2 12,5 13,7
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2024
  • Sources: Insee, RP1968 to 1999 counts, RP2010 to RP2021 main holdings - Civil status
